Note
  • Based on presentations made at two conferences, the first held in 2014 at the Federal University of Pelotas in Brazil, and the second held in 2015 at the University of Siegen, Germany.
Bibliography (note)
  • Includes bibliographical references and indexes.
Contents
Antirealist interpretations of Kant: Transcendental and empirical levels of moral realism and idealism / Frederick Rauscher -- Kantian constructivism, respect, and moral depth / Melissa Zinkin -- Realist interpretations of Kant: Kant's theory of historical progress: a case of realism or antirealism? / Christoph Horn -- Dignity and the paradox of method / Patrick Kain -- Practical cognition, reflective judgment, and the realism of Kant's moral Glaube / Lara Ostaric -- Kant's moral realism regarding dignity and value : some comments on the Tugendlehre / Elke Elisabeth Schmidt & Dieter Schönecker -- Something in between: Moral realism by other means: the hybrid nature of Kant's practical rationalism / Stefano Bacin -- Why Kant is not a moral intuitionist / Jochen Bojanowski -- Kant's constitutivism / Oliver Sensen.
